If you are a recent graduate or an industry expert and interested in a career in teaching, Herefordshire, Ludlow and North Shropshire College (HLNSC) is offering an exciting opportunity for you to join our Graduate/Industry Expert Scheme, designed to support individuals to train, teach and build a long term career within further education. You do not need a teaching qualification – we will support you to gain one as part of the role.
1. Up to six positions available
2. Full-time, fixed term 22 months
3. Salary: £29,367
Your week will typically include:
4. Teaching a half timetable in year 1, and 0.75 timetable in year 2, delivering your subject specialism.
5. Dedicated training time to complete the Level 5 Learning & Skills Teacher Apprenticeship (funded by the college).
6. Industry or sector engagement time to maintain subject and vocational currency.
7. Pastoral and academic coaching on 1:1 or small group basis.
You will be fully supported by experienced teaching and learning mentors, and curriculum leaders as you develop your confidence, skills and professional practice.
